Photo credit: Rachael Pellegrino Description: In South Africa, there is a tradition called sundowners. It is a time to talk, relax, and give a final salute to the sun as it sets. In Kruger National Park, this happens every evening to cap off a day of research and game drives. Many of the researchers and residents of the area come to the side of this lake and socialize. We were in this area finishing and compiling our own research and thus joined in the daily ritual.
